3M PPS 2.0 H/O Pressure Cup with Air Hose

Designed for professionals tackling high-viscosity coatings, the 3M PPS 2.0 H/O Pressure Cup with Air Hose offers a reliable full-system solution. With a large 28-ounce capacity, it’s ideal for spraying thick materials like primers, varnishes, and truck bed liners. Made of durable metal, it includes a pressure cup, collar, and air hose, ensuring smooth operation. The system forces air through the hose to collapse the liner, delivering a consistent spray pattern and reducing waste. It boosts productivity by up to 50%, minimizes cleanup, and allows quick switching between materials with reusable liners. Perfect for industrial use, it’s a solid choice for professional painters.

Spray Pattern Adjustment
Adjusting the spray pattern on an HVLP turbine system with a 3M PPS cup is essential for achieving even and professional finishes. Most systems have adjustable pattern control knobs that let you switch from narrow to wide fan sizes. Fine-tuning involves balancing air flow and fluid flow to get the right spray width and atomization. Understanding how trigger pull, air pressure, and fluid volume work together helps in making precise adjustments. Proper pattern control minimizes overspray and edge buildup, resulting in a cleaner, more consistent coat. Whether you’re working on detailed trim or large surfaces, adjusting the spray pattern ensures you use materials efficiently and achieve a smooth, professional look. Mastering this adjustment is key to expert-quality results with your HVLP system.

Nozzle Size Options
Have you considered how nozzle size impacts your spray quality and project efficiency? The options typically range from 1.2mm to 2.0mm, allowing you to customize spray patterns and material flow. Smaller nozzles, like 1.2mm to 1.4mm, are perfect for fine finishes and detailed work, giving you smooth, precise results. Larger nozzles, from 1.8mm to 2.0mm, are better suited for thicker coatings and covering larger areas quickly. Choosing the right nozzle size ensures ideal atomization, which reduces overspray and material waste. Keep in mind, compatibility depends on your HVLP turbine model and application needs. Having multiple sizes on hand offers versatility, letting you adapt to different coating types, viscosities, and project requirements with ease.
